Ọrọ Iṣaaju
H.264 ni a gbajumo fidio funmorawon bošewa lati compress a oni fidio. O ti wa ni a tun mo bi MPEG-4 Part10 tabi To ti ni ilọsiwaju Video ifaminsi (MPEG-4 AVC). H.264 nlo ọna ọgbọn-ọlọgbọn fun titẹpọ fidio kan nibiti iwọn idina ti ṣe asọye bi 16 x 16 ati pe iru bulọọki ni a pe ni bulọọki macro. Boṣewa funmorawon ṣe atilẹyin ọpọlọpọ awọn profiles ti o setumo awọn funmorawon ratio ati complexity ti imuse. Awọn fireemu fidio lati wa ni fisinuirindigbindigbin ni a tọju bi I-Frame, P-Frame, ati B-Frame. I-fireemu jẹ fireemu ti o ni koodu inu nibiti a ti ṣe funmorawon nipa lilo alaye ti o wa ninu fireemu naa. Ko si awọn fireemu miiran ti o nilo lati yan koodu I-fireemu naa. A P-Fireemu ti wa ni fisinuirindigbindigbin nipa lilo awọn ayipada pẹlu ọwọ si ohun sẹyìn fireemu ti o le jẹ ẹya I-Fireemu tabi a P-Fireemu. Awọn funmorawon ti B-fireemu ti wa ni ṣe nipa lilo awọn išipopada ayipada pẹlu ọwọ si mejeji ohun sẹyìn fireemu ati awọn ẹya ìṣe fireemu. Ilana funmorawon I-Frame ni awọn s mẹrintages-Asọtẹlẹ Intra, Iyipada Integer, Quantization, ati fifi koodu Entropy. H.264 ṣe atilẹyin fun awọn oriṣi meji ti fifi koodu - Iyipada Iyipada Iyipada Ipari Ipari (CAVLC) ati Ifaminsi Oniṣiro Alakomeji Atokun (CABAC). Ẹya lọwọlọwọ ti IP ṣe imuse Baseline profile o si nlo CAVLC fun fifi koodu entropy. Paapaa, IP ṣe atilẹyin fifi koodu ti I-Frames nikan titi di ipinnu 4K.
Awọn ẹya ara ẹrọ
H.264 I-Frame Encoder ṣe atilẹyin ẹya bọtini atẹle:
- Ṣe imuṣe funmorawon lori ọna kika fidio YCbCr 420
- Reti Input ni YCbCr 422 Fidio kika
- Ṣe atilẹyin awọn bit 8 fun Ẹka Kọọkan (Y, Cb, ati Cr)
- Ṣe atilẹyin ITU-T H.264 Annex B Ibaramu NAL baiti Iṣajade ṣiṣan
- Isẹ Aṣojuuṣe, Sipiyu, tabi Iranlọwọ Oluṣeto Ko beere
- Olumulo Configurable Didara ifosiwewe QP Nigba Run Time
- Iṣiro ni Oṣuwọn 1 pixel fun Aago kan
- Ṣe atilẹyin fun funmorawon titi de Ipinnu ti 4K (3840 × 2160) 60fps
- Ibalẹ ti o kere (252 μs fun HD ni kikun tabi awọn laini petele 17)
- Ṣe atilẹyin awọn ege 2 ati 4

Hardware imuse ti H.264 4K I-Frame Encoder IP
H.264 4K I-Frame Encoder IP pin fireemu kọọkan si awọn ege 2/4 ati awọn koodu nipa lilo koodu koodu bibẹ. DDR kika kannaa retí fireemu data ni DDR iranti bi YCbCr 422 kika. Aafo ila laarin gbogbo petele ila ti fireemu ni DDR iranti gbọdọ wa ni pato nipasẹ DDR_LINE_GAP_I input. IP naa nlo awọn ọna kika 422 bi titẹ sii ati imuse funmorawon ni awọn ọna kika 420. Ijade Slice0 tun ni SPS ati akọsori PPS ninu. Gbogbo ṣiṣan bit ege ti pese ni lọtọ. Gbogbo ege bit san darapọ papo di ik H.264 bit san. Encoder Bibẹ Apejuwe Design
Yi apakan apejuwe awọn ti o yatọ ti abẹnu modulu ti awọn bibẹ encoder.
16 x 16 Matrix Framer
module yi fireemu 16 x 16 Makiro ohun amorindun fun Y paati bi fun H.264 sipesifikesonu. Awọn buffers laini ni a lo lati tọju awọn laini petele 16 ti aworan titẹ sii, ati pe matrix 16 x 16 ti wa ni tito nipa lilo awọn iforukọsilẹ iyipada.
8 x 8 Matrix Framer
Module yii ṣe awọn bulọọki Makiro 8 x 8 fun paati C gẹgẹ bi sipesifikesonu H.264 fun awọn ọna kika 420. Awọn buffers laini ni a lo lati fipamọ awọn laini petele 8 ti aworan titẹ sii, ati pe matrix 8 x 16 kan ti wa ni tito nipa lilo awọn iforukọsilẹ iyipada. Lati matrix 8 x 16, awọn paati Cb ati Cr ti yapa lati ṣe fireemu matrix 8 x 8 kọọkan.
4 x 4 Matrix Framer
Iyipada odidi, titobi, ati fifi koodu CAVLC ṣiṣẹ lori 4 x 4 sub-block laarin macroblock kan. Awọn fireemu matrix 4 x 4 ṣe ipilẹṣẹ 4 x 4 sub-block lati 16 x 16 tabi 8 x 8 macroblock. Olupilẹṣẹ matrix yii tan nipasẹ gbogbo awọn bulọọki iha ti macroblock ṣaaju lilọ si macroblock atẹle.
Asọtẹlẹ inu
H.264 nlo orisirisi awọn ipo asọtẹlẹ inu lati dinku alaye ni 4 x 4 Àkọsílẹ. Àkọsílẹ intra-asotele ninu IP nlo 4 x 4 nikan tabi 16 x 16 DC asọtẹlẹ. 16 x 16 ni a lo fun awọn iye QP diẹ sii ju 35 ti o ba jẹ pe asọtẹlẹ intra-DC 16 x 16 ṣiṣẹ ni atunto IP. Awọn paati DC ti wa ni iṣiro lati oke nitosi ati osi 4 x 4 tabi 16 x 16 awọn bulọọki.
Odidi Iyipada
H.264 nlo iyipada cosine ọtọtọ odidi nibiti a ti pin awọn onisọdipúpọ kọja matrix iyipada odidi ati matrix titobi bii ko si isodipupo tabi awọn ipin ninu iyipada odidi. Odidi odidi stage ṣe iyipada ni lilo iyipada ati ṣafikun awọn iṣẹ.
Quantization
Isọdiwọn npọ sijade kọọkan ti iyipada odidi pẹlu iye iwọn ti a ti pinnu tẹlẹ nipasẹ iye igbewọle olumulo QP. Ibiti o ti QP iye ni lati 0 to 51. Eyikeyi iye diẹ sii ju 51 ni clamped to 51. Iwọn QP kekere kan tọka si titẹkuro kekere ati didara ti o ga julọ ati idakeji.
CAVLC
H.264 nlo awọn oriṣi meji ti fifi koodu entropy-Context Adaptive Variable Length Coding (CAVLC) ati Context Adaptive Binary Arithmetic Coding (CABAC). IP naa nlo CAVLC fun fifi koodu si iṣelọpọ ti iwọn.
Akọsori monomono
Bulọọki monomono akọsori n ṣe ipilẹṣẹ awọn akọle idina, awọn akọle bibẹ, Ṣeto Paramita Ọkọọkan (SPS), Eto Paramita Aworan (PPS), ati Ẹka Abstraction Network (NAL) ti o da lori apẹẹrẹ ti fireemu fidio naa.
H.264 ṣiṣan monomono
Àkọsílẹ monomono ṣiṣan H.264 ṣopọpọ iṣelọpọ CAVLC pẹlu awọn akọle lati ṣẹda abajade ti a fi koodu si gẹgẹbi ọna kika boṣewa H.264.
